					<description><![CDATA[Well Designed But Rather Small And A Bit Drab Looking
While it’s not yet time to start learning the alphabet, this set seemed like it might be the perfect toy for our youngest granddaughter; she is fascinated by animals and really enjoys manipulating toys which are able to be fitted together and subsequently taken apart. Even if she doesn’t use them to introduce the alphabet, it’s a lovely way for our daughter to teach her child the names of a wide range of common animals.The design of the blocks is quite ingenious; for every letter in the alphabet, an animal whose name starts with that letter has been selected and, in one way or another, the letter shape has been incorporated into their body to create a two piece puzzle. The pieces include just upper case letters; while the letters are fully painted on all sides, the animals appear on only one side to ensure that the letters appear in their correct orientation when put together with the animal. Given the ages which this set is meant to appeal to, my wife and I found it surprising that the animal representations are in relatively subdued colours and tend to lack any real “personality” to make them more interesting. While the letters are very useful by themselves, it should be noted that many of them are not free standing; even when paired correctly with their corresponding animal piece, this remains an issue.The animal figures and their paired letters are all made of wood and have been very nicely crafted and finished; all edges have been rounded and we were unable to find any chipped paint or other imperfections. The letters all fit nicely into their allotted locations on the animal blocks although we were disappointed that some letters fit into multiple animals making incorrect identifications possible. I was impressed that the designers made a real effort to create animal blocks which didn’t have narrow sections that would lead to weak spots and easy breakage. These toys should be able to withstand fairly rigorous play.The box the set comes in is quite nice; while it would work well for storage, I would have liked to have seen an optional storage bag included with the set. While the back of the box has a small diagram illustrating the correct assembly of the animal/letter pairs, it would have been nice if a larger, more child friendly diagram had been included.My wife and I found the wooden pieces a bit small; had they (both letters and animals) been slightly larger, it would have made it easier for younger children to manipulate them. These figures are small enough that they shouldn’t be left out in the presence of young children who still mouth their toys; some of the letters and animals present a choking hazard.Aimed at preschool children, this set is useful in building an animal vocabulary, helping develop fine motor skills, and improving letter recognition and identifying letter sounds. The figures are easily identifiable and, if not inspiring, of interest to most children. This would make a good gift for almost any toddler.]]></description>

					<description><![CDATA[Durable and educational
This puzzle is such a wonderful educational resource! It helps children not only identify the animals within the puzzle, but sounding out the initial letter of the word, and then recognizing visually the letter that goes with it. The puzzle itself does have grooves within the animals that aid in identifying the correct letter associated with the animal (example in bear you can see the two bumps within the capital b), but not distinctive enough that the child doesn’t have to rely on memory and knowledge of that animal/letter.The pieces are very thick and extremely durable! They have a coding on them that makes it easy to clean without damaging the toy. The box comes with two bags so that you can separately store the letters and the animals if you choose. The pieces do have a bit of a smell when you open the bag but if you leave them for about 20 minutes that smell dissipates. The colours are vivid, and the pictures are clear. It looks just like the image listed on the advertisement.]]></description>

					<description><![CDATA[Quality made, Alphabet/ Animal puzzle. Great way to grow imagination, learn and play.
This Montessori, Wooden, Animal/ Alphabet- Combination Puzzle comes with 52 pieces to match up and put together. It truly promotes hands on play and helps children connect animals to specific letters in the Alphabet. It teaches them the letters, color recognition, and animal recognition and helps grow their imagination.It was difficult for my 3 year old to figure out on his own what letter belonged with what animal, but working with me and his older brother he really loved playing with this Wooden puzzle set and asked so much questions, that enhanced his cognative learning. It awakened his curiosity and he loved playing with all the animals, in his own precious way. I know he will grow with this quality toy and will use it accordingly as he ages and learns that much more.I appreciate that it is made of quality wood, and every piece is painted with non- toxic paint. Each piece is free of sharp edges and is safe for a child to play with. This gives me a piece of mind when my child plays with this set. I just wish the pieces were a bit bigger in size. Also, its a bit overpriced for what it is, $35 at this time.Still, it&#039;s a great little set to have in my little ones toy collection that not only he can play with, but a toy he can learn from in a variety of different ways. Like it very much and recommend.]]></description>

					<description><![CDATA[Fun, Educational Alphabet &amp; Animal Puzzle Set
This set of alphabet letters and animals was exactly as advertised and is a really smart idea for a toy. The pieces are lightweight yet feel well-made, and the colors and designs of both the letters and animals are high quality.The recommended age range of 3+ feels accurate. The animals are easy to recognize and pair nicely with their matching letters. I can see how this toy would be great for helping children learn the alphabet, animal names, and how puzzle pieces fit together.My only small critique is that I expected the parts to be a little larger (the letters are about 2” tall and the animals around 3”), but given the price, I still think it’s a great value and I’m very happy with it. And finally the two different components come plastic bags, it would be nice if it were a nice material but not a deal breaker.Pros:• Lightweight but durable pieces• Bright, high-quality colors and designs• Educational: teaches letters, animals, and puzzle skills• Good value for the priceCons:• Pieces are a bit smaller than expected]]></description>
